    3.3 Date/Time Format

    Since: 0.5

    Columns that provide date and time information conforming to specified rules and formatting requirements ensure clarity, accuracy, and ease of interpretation for both humans and systems.

    All columns capturing a date/time value, defined in the FOCUS specification, MUST follow the formatting requirements listed below. Custom date/time-related columns SHOULD also follow the same formatting requirements.

    3.3.3 Description

    Rules and formatting requirements for date/time-related columns appearing in a FOCUS dataset.

    3.3.4 Requirements

    • Date/time values MUST be in UTC (Coordinated Universal Time) to avoid ambiguity and ensure consistency across different time zones.
    • Date/time values format MUST be aligned with ISO 8601 standard, which provides a globally recognized format for representing dates and times (see ISO 8601-1:2019 governing document for details).
    • Values providing information about a specific moment in time MUST be represented in the extended ISO 8601 format with UTC offset ('YYYY-MM-DDTHH:mm:ssZ') and conform to the following guidelines:
      • Include the date and time components, separated with the letter 'T'
      • Use two-digit hours (HH), minutes (mm), and seconds (ss).
      • End with the 'Z' indicator to denote UTC (Coordinated Universal Time)

    3.3.5 Exceptions

    None
